Transaction bfb338573e5277666b9083d8fdb8c7e96472e7f6f010da29d92b08459c23e027
1 Input
1 Output
-
bfb338573e5277666b9083d8fdb8c7e96472e7f6f010da29d92b08459c23e027:0
- value
- 3071609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f704a083a546240d62c76fa13486623c96b77de OP_EQUAL
- address
- 37UT1cqLYEPz8ttscdZGjctxopSTEU2vga